Local tips

  • Wear comfortable hiking shoes as the trail to the cave can be uneven.
  • Bring water and snacks for the hike.
  • Consider visiting early in the morning or late afternoon for the best lighting for photography.
  • Bring a flashlight or headlamp for exploring the cave's interior.

Getting There

  • Public Transport

    From Tirana's city center, go to the 'Qendra Tregtare Univers' bus station. Look for Bus number 29 heading towards Pellumbas. The fare is approximately 40 ALL. Ride the bus for about 30 minutes until you reach the 'Pellumbas' stop. From there, follow the signs to the Black Cave and Canyon Tour; the hiking trail starts in the village.

  • Taxi

    Take a taxi from anywhere in Tirana to Pellumbas, Berzhite, Tirana 1001, Albania. The drive is approximately 30 minutes and should cost around 1500-2000 ALL. The taxi will drop you off near the entrance to the Black Cave and Canyon Tour, where the hiking trail begins.

  • Car

    From the center of Tirana, head south on the SH1 highway. Continue for approximately 45 minutes until you reach the exit for Pellumbas. Follow the signs for Pellumbas on a smaller road. After about 10 minutes, you will arrive at the entrance of Black Cave and Canyon Tour Pellumbas. Parking availability may vary.

Discover more about Black Cave and Canyon Tour Pellumbas

The Black Cave, also known as Pellumbas Cave (Shpella e Zezë or Shpella e Pëllumbasit), is a karst cave located in central Albania, near the village of Pellumbas in Tirana County. Situated in the Skorana Gorge, it lies approximately 500 meters above the Adriatic Sea, on the slopes of the Dajti mountain chain. The cave stretches approximately 360 meters in length, with a width varying between 10 to 15 meters and a vertical range of 45 meters. Inside, you'll find stunning stalactites and stalagmites, evidence of the cave's long geological history. The cave has been recognized as a natural monument of national and international importance. Archaeological findings suggest that the cave was inhabited from the Paleolithic period through the Medieval period. It was also a shelter for the villagers of Pellumbas during World War II. Fossils attributed to cave bears that lived over 10,000 years ago have been discovered within the cave. The hike to Pellumbas Cave from Pellumbas village is about 2 km and takes approximately one hour. The trail offers spectacular views of the Erzen Canyon.
